Your role will be to build a community by recruiting students and employers, work with applications for admissions, manage operations staff as the campus grows as well as manage business operations, and to create a great learning environment.
In your day to day role, you'll be out doing a lot of networking to meet potential students and employers as well as hosting events in our space. Closer to graduation, you'll work with students on their resumes, portfolios and job applications.
The part that you'll love most is helping the students to get a high-paying career that they'll enjoy, changing their lives for the better, and making grateful friends in the process.
